How do you thicken a curry?

Add one tablespoon of cornflour to two or three tablespoons of cold water and stir. Pour the mixture into the sauce and allow to simmer until the sauce begins to thicken. Which doesn't take very long. Ideal for Indian curries and can be used as a cream substitute (which is also thickens sauces).

Is yellow curry paste the same as Massaman?

Yellow curry pastes are colored by turmeric and Indian-style curry powder; their spice level is relatively mild. Panang curry paste is similar to red but with the addition of ground peanuts. A fifth style, called Massaman (or Masmun) curry paste, is more Malaysian in influence; it's also relatively mild.

Can you turn curry powder into curry paste?

Curry Paste. Curry pastes are just a combination of freshly ground curry powders, ginger, garlic, herbs and salt. Add all to a food processor or blender and you've got an easy homemade, thick curry pastes (in under 10 minutes!).

What’s the difference between yellow and green curry?

Yellow curry, green curry — what's the difference? "Yellow curry is yellow due to the presence of turmeric in the paste whereas green curry is green due to the green chilies in the paste," she wrote. "The ingredients traditionally used in both curries are also different."

What is galangal powder?

What is Galangal powder? Galangal powder is dried, ground galangal root. Galangal is a member of the ginger family and is used in Thai, Malaysian, Vietnamese, Indonesian, Laotian and Cambodian cooking. Typically fresh galangal root is preferred. Is panang curry spicy?

Panang curry has an additional ingredient which isn't used in Red or Green curry paste. It's ground peanuts and Panang is usually seasoned to be less spicy but much sweeter than the red curry. The actual translation is "Sweet Green Curry" while the red curry is "Spicy Curry". Among the three, Panang is the sweetest.

What is yellow sour curry paste?

Southern sour curry paste is also known as yellow sour curry paste because of the bright yellow color of the curry. The southerners, however, call this curry 'sour curry'. But elsewhere, especially in Bangkok, this curry paste is known as yellow curry paste.

What is curry powder made of?

Curry powder is usually a mixture of turmeric, chilli powder, ground coriander, ground cumin, ground ginger and pepper, and can be bought in mild, medium or hot strengths.

How do you use yellow curry powder?

You get the best results from curry powder if you blend it with a liquid before adding it to your dish. The liquid allows the flavors of the spice that make up the curry powder to fully infuse into the dish. Options include yogurt, coconut milk or stock.

What is red curry paste made of?

How to Make Red Curry Paste. The base is red bell pepper, red chilies, garlic, ginger, and green onion or shallot. Spices come in the form of turmeric, coriander, cumin, sea salt, and black peppercorn. And for a little acidity, I used both lime and lemon juice as well as lime zest.
